Subject2.3 wish: integrate pcmcia into mainstream kernel
Hi!

`subj` is my 2.3 wish. Having pcmcia support outside of standard
kernel makes pcmcia drivers second-class citizens, which only work
sometimes. I do not think that pcmcia package is developing so fast
that it could not be integrated into mainstream. And, btw, mainstream
kernels need support for hotplug, anyway, see hotpluggable PCI and
USB.
